Nigeria: Oil Leak - Exxonmobil Shuts in Production

22 November 2012

Lagos — After almost two weeks of battling oil leak at its Ibeno facility offshore Akwa Ibom State, the Nigerian unit US-based Oil giant, ExxonMobil, is forced to shut down production.

Refraining from disclosing how much production was affected in spite of prodding, the oil company in a statement, yesterday, "declared force majeure due to the difficulty in meeting projected liftings because of repair work on a section of pipeline affected in a November 9 oil release incident."
